Decentralization is not merely a technical preference—it is a strategic necessity. Centralized systems are inherently vulnerable; a single failure can trigger cascading collapse. Pi Network addresses this risk by distributing responsibility across thousands of independent nodes, each operating as a guardian of the network. Nodes collectively maintain consensus, verify transactions, and provide redundancy, ensuring the network’s reliability even when parts of it fail. This distributed architecture transforms fragility into resilience, chaos into order, and risk into manageable, predictable processes.

Security is reinforced through redundancy and collective validation. Each node validates transactions independently yet communicates with the network to maintain consensus. This approach ensures that even if multiple nodes fail or go offline, the system continues to operate reliably. In contrast to centralized systems, where a single point of failure can trigger catastrophic loss, Pi Network’s distributed nodes safeguard the network against disruption and maintain continuity for users worldwide.

The network’s resilience is evident in its ability to scale. As participation increases and new nodes come online, Pi Network accommodates growth without compromising security or functionality. Each new Pioneer strengthens the system, expanding the network’s capacity and reinforcing its redundancy. This scalability ensures that Picoin remains functional as a medium of exchange, a store of value, and a platform for decentralized applications as the ecosystem expands globally.
